测试管理 从多快好省到好快省多,您的项目管理走对了吗?

陈哥聊测试 · 2022年03月25日 · 最后由 无人机 回复于 2023年03月03日 · 3493 次阅读

2021 年 8 月,字节跳动教育及游戏板块大规模裁员,
2021 年 8 月,腾讯微视人员优化,裁员比例高达 70%,
2021 年 12 月,爱奇艺大规模裁员,比例高达 20%-40%,
2021 年 11 月,快手在脉脉上被爆料将裁员 30%,
2021 年 12 月,蘑菇街裁员,比例大概在 30%,
2022 年 1 月,拼多多被爆 “戏剧化” 裁员,
2022 年 3 月,互联网大厂裁员又上热搜……

除了以上列举的,字节跳动、有赞等也爆出裁员风波,2021 年以来的互联网裁员,近期正愈演愈烈,除了看得到的业务模块精简、省年终奖等原因,我们也不妨做出推断,背后的另一重要原因也可能是,这些大厂步入了项目管理的传统思维——追求多快好省的顺序。

提起项目管理的目标,脑海中第一涌现的往往是 “怎样多快好省地完成一件事情”,多是项目范围管理,快是项目时间管理,好是项目质量管理,省是项目成本管理。虽然这样说,但如果也遵循这个顺序,则很可能陷入项目管理的误区。

多、快、好、省的顺序是老生常谈了,但,从来如此,便对么?

互联网高速发展时期,每家企业都想把握住风口,抓住时代脉搏,达成 “多” 的成就。但此时的发展往往只顾 “多” 和 “快”,从未关注交付的是什么、会给社会带来什么影响,忽视产品价值这个最根本的因素。然而我国的互联网产业经过 20 年的发展,整体可以说已经过了红利期,增量市场已转向存量市场,这种局势下即便是几家大厂也不太会有能高速增长的增量业务。当这只被风吹起的猪终于落地,一味贪多求快而被掩盖的问题也就浮现出来了。项目管理的多快好省顺序,就已经不再适用。

在如今的存量市场,从优先级角度来看,“好” 应该是毋庸置疑处于第一位的;然后是聚焦于交付,更 “快” 地交付高质量产品;在这样的基础上,拥有 “省” 人力 “省” 时间的经营意识;完成前三项的前提下,“多” 只会是自然而然的客观结果,而不是需要刻意追求的目标。

说回大厂的裁员,这正是之前一味追求 “多” 的后果:以加人、加班、加钱的方式快速推出产品,“好” 则通过大量的宣传、包装来完成,鲜花着锦、烈火烹油后,想起追求 “省” 了,于是又开始大规模收缩。然而最终,追求 “多快好省” 的后果却要由每一个独立的个体来承担。

说完错误思维,我们来看看项目管理的正确顺序该如何。

从多快好省到好快省多

好:“好” 是做事的目标。

这个 “好” 并不仅仅指产品固有属性,如质量过硬、不存在 Bug 等,还包含着对用户的价值及对社会的价值。比如现在很多吸引注意力以达成贩卖流量目的的产品,其功能做的非常棒,UI 也十分美观,然而产生的大部分 “价值”,不过是把越来越多的人困在信息流中,娱乐至死。所以,项目管理的 “好”,一定是做好的东西,价值优先,产生价值交付。离开价值的 “好”,其他几项都只是徒劳。

有价值的 “好” 会经得起时间的检验,苹果以一己之力改变了全世界的手机市场,取消实体键盘、多点触控、滑动触摸、语音操作、压敏力反馈界面……如此多的特性一直被智能手机保留至今,互联网也随之进入移动互联网时代。

快:“快” 是做事的方式。

强调快是强调做事目的要聚焦于交付,集中精力把一件好的、有价值的事情交付。VUCA 时代,面对复杂多变的市场形势,项目管理需要快速反应、快速迭代、快速发布,这样的敏捷性和灵活性也是 “快” 的一种体现。

但归根结底,“快” 和其他几项的前提都要建立在达成 “好” 这个目标之上,一定程度上,要克制追求时间的冲动,不能只顾一味求 “快”,揠苗助长。比如,以一味加班来缓解害怕落后于市场的焦虑,不仅会让程序员的健康状况每况愈下,而且会侵占员工每天的 “充电” 时间,员工甚至丧失对新事物的接收力和自主思考能力,越来越多 “高级机器人” 就此诞生,创新难免成为凤毛麟角。长此以往,只会陷入一个个恶性循环。

省:“省” 是具备一定的经营意识。

项目管理不仅要把事情做好做快,也要协调好资源,即做到投入产出比最大化。研发团队可能离市场、成本、收入等情况较远,但同样需要具备关注效率、控制成本的意识。要着眼于企业当前经营情况,在项目管理方面进行流程改进、工程实践,以同样的人,做更多的事,省人力、省资源。

多:“多” 是做好了以上三项的客观结果。

当好、快、省都做好做对,产品所叠加的价值也就会越来越多,用户、客户、市场占有率、盈利等会随着产品的价值点增加而自然地水涨船高。“多” 绝不是项目管理的目标,一味求多是贪婪的表现。项目只需要完成规定的内容即可,团队按照需求做好本迭代工作,不必 “镀金”。如果以 “多” 为目标,那么项目永远都没有完工的一天。

好、快、省、多的顺序有其内在逻辑,若一开始就舍本逐末,一味追求 “多”、贪图 “快”,忽视了最本质的质量和价值,反而可能会欲速则不达。如很多公司所谓的秉持 “客户第一” 的原则,其实是不肯放弃的 “钱第一” 原则,这样一开始就奔着钱去的,结果往往适得其反。

如何做到 “好、快、省、多”?

根据上述论述,要达到 “多” 的客观结果,就势必要从前三项出发,在质量管理、时间管理和成本管理上发力,达成质量的 “好” 和交付的 “多” 这个自然而然的结果。

1.实时监控项目进度,项目计划与执行合二为一

从宏观到微观,把握项目进度。从公司价值观到战略目标,逐渐落到产品规划和具体实践上来,同时合理运用软件工程实践和项目管理工具。

通过禅道,可以进行项目集、项目、产品、执行的多层级管理;同时,各项统计报表可以帮助管理层及项目经理实时了解项目动态,对出现问题和风险的地方进行及时的调整。

2.注重短期质量的同时,不忽视长期质量

短期质量容易看到也容易达成,如测试左移、单元测试、测试报告、上线后是否有 Bug 等,长期质量却容易被忽视。长期质量是不影响上线初期的体验、但两三年后会逐渐暴露出来的架构弊端或技术缺陷,比如系统的可扩展性、灵活度等,长期质量的问题将对软件的可持续发展产生极大影响,需要在项目最初就避免。

1.借助敏捷实践

敏捷开发正是顺应市场需求变化快、交付节奏加快应运而生的,可以说完美契合了项目管理在 VUCA 时代所需的灵活性。

可以借助敏捷的一些具体方法、以及合适的项目管理工具来提高效率,聚焦价值。

如通过 Scrum 的每日站会、Kanban 的可视化来同步进度,减少因信息不透明导致的周期过长。极限编程的代码集体所有制、代码命名规范等,可以避免重复造轮子、增强团队合作,达到高复用、提高效率的目标。

2.引入自动化

自动化的出现是为了减少可编程系统、机械操作的活动所需的人力,目的是简化繁重、重复和复杂的工作,使其更有效也更高效。通过这种方式,可以节省资源、时间和成本,被解放的人力可以集中精力聚焦于更有价值、更有质量的 “好” 的那部分工作。

自动化测试就是将手动测试需要遵循的步骤被转化成可重复的脚本,更轻松地完成规模化、工程化测试。

1.严格遵循 “快” 的工程实践

“省” 是项目管理里面的省时间、省资源、省人力,由此可见,“省” 与上述的 “快” 密不可分。遵循敏捷、自动化这些工程实践,达成聚焦价值、提高效率的目标,成本、时间等资源自然而然就省下来了。

2.具备一定的经营意识

软件研发中的项目管理主力军往往是研发团队,研发团队可能离市场、成本、收入等情况较远,容易忽视成本、经营等相关方面。阿米巴经营可以建立各个团队与市场的联系,通过独立核算、分算奖的交易,让每一个成员都能充分发挥潜在积极性,实现 “全员参与” 的经营方式。每位成员都将自己作为团队的经营者,都会有意识地提升效率、降低成本。

多,是好快省的客观结果。好、快、省都做好了,质量有保障,效率有提升,产品所叠加的价值也就会越来越多;成本省下来,利润升上去,积累下来的用户、盈利也就会越来越多。

您的项目管理,是时候从多快好省的粗放式野蛮生长转向高质量可持续发展的好快省多了!

共收到 2 条回复 时间 点赞

这个文章好有深度啊很 nice,结合当前的大厂普遍裁员增效的事件引申到项目管理,受教了!

需要 登录 后方可回复, 如果你还没有账号请点击这里 注册